Job Description

1. Ensures adherence of production processes to quality policy and procedures based on the company's Quality and Environmental Systems.
2. Oversees the proper implementation of process control in each process section.
3. In-charge of close monitoring of 1st production batches.
4. Participates actively in process control development. This includes introduction of new processes and all its related process changes through coordination with R&D.
5. Ensures the proper implementation of the first lot control, design, review, RM-QA and determine the requirement under production procedure of the process order.
6. Conducts study on how to utilize non- conforming products.
7. Ensures quality data collection and reporting for analysis and action if necessary.
8. Participates in the process development and operation control where proper documentation is necessary for each production process.
9. Reports to immediate superior for any abnormalities noted during or after each process. Closely coordinates with concerned department and make necessary countermeasures.
10. In-charge in the close monitoring of first production batches of new products or new color, identify problems for corrective measures by Technical. Establish standard processing of the products based on the First Batch Control System.
11. Familiarity with the formulation and formula guidelines for any batch adjustments required.
12. Updates process standards in order to check whether all the set-up standards are being followed and in order to come up with necessary improvements.
13. Prepares process control requirements, do material handling, packaging inspection, test support and troubleshooting requirements.
14. Conducts process audit in order to cope up with the necessary improvement.

Qualifications/Requirements

Bachelor's degree in chemistry or another related course (preferably licensed)
With at least 1-year relevant experience
Must have knowledge in Basic Paint Technology
Must have strong analytical and interpersonal skills.
Must have good written and oral communication skills.
